Question 366630: In triangle ABC, angle B is five times as large as angle C. Angle A
measures 5 degrees more than angle C. Calculate the angles of the triangle(angles A,B,C_. The sum of all angles equal 180 degrees.

let angle c be x
angle b = 5x
angle a = x+5
...
x+x+5+5x= 180
7x+5=180
7x=180-5
7x=175
/7
x=25 deg. ....angle c
angle b = 5x= 125
angle a = x+5 = 30
